Re: 1997 355AC not able to pull from aux tank
1) Lift the starboard nightstand top off by pulling straight up on it
2) Remove the drawer
3) There are about 6 screws that fasten the cabinet to the fiberglass floor. Remove all screws and the cabinet will slide out
4) There are two screws that hold the padded bolster that spans above the bed and cabinet, you’ll have to run your fingers across the bottom edge against the back wall to feel for the dimples where the screws are. The bolster just pulls right out after removing the screws. You’re 60 seconds away!! The “wall” is held in by Velcro and you’ll see the loops on the bottom of the two pieces of the wall to pull on to remove them. The Velcro is strong, don’t be shy. You’re there!!
The larger fuel line is the supply line (1/2”), the smaller line is the fuel return line (3/8”). The 1/2” line will have the check-valve. There will be two sets of each (One for each engine).
When putting any fittings back in the tank, be sure to use teflon tape or fuel proof thread sealant. If using Teflon tape, be sure to wrap the threads NO LESS than 4 times.
